What is nationwide authorized case level

The Nationwide Authorized Case Level Signature Form is a business document used by plan sponsors to authorize specific employees to make changes to retirement plans.

What is the Nationwide Authorized Case Level Signature Form?

The Nationwide Authorized Case Level Signature Form is a crucial document for plan sponsors and employees involved in retirement plan management. Its primary function is to authorize specific actions by employees concerning retirement plans. This form is typically utilized by plan sponsors and employees to streamline the process of managing retirement fund changes. It's important to note that this is not an IRS form but serves a distinct purpose within business contracts.

Key Features of the Nationwide Authorized Case Level Signature Form

This form encompasses several key components essential for its proper function:
  • Required fields include names, titles, phone numbers, email addresses, and signatures.
  • A specific section is dedicated to the signatures of plan sponsors, authorizing employee permissions.
  • The form complies with established security standards, ensuring that sensitive information is adequately protected.
